The PL061 supports interrupts and those can be wakeup interrupts. We
need to provide support for configuring those interrupts as wakeup
sources.

This patch adds irq_set_wake callback for PL061 so that GPIO interrupts
can be configured as wakeup.

+static int pl061_irq_set_wake(struct irq_data *d, unsigned int state)
+{
+       struct gpio_chip *gc = irq_data_get_irq_chip_data(d);
+
+       return irq_set_irq_wake(gc->irq_parent, state);
+}
+
 static struct irq_chip pl061_irqchip = {
        .name           = "pl061",
        .irq_ack        = pl061_irq_ack,
        .irq_mask       = pl061_irq_mask,
        .irq_unmask     = pl061_irq_unmask,
        .irq_set_type   = pl061_irq_type,
+       .irq_set_wake   = pl061_irq_set_wake,
 };
